If you used the original trap it may be as simple as the trap is clogged. We frequent the beach ans thus an above average amount of sand ends up in the trap. I took a simple bath tub stopper, that fits the drain, and drilled a hole through the center of it. Put the stopper in the drain and apply a garden hose to the stopper and turn on the water. That pressure will move anything that has settled in the trap.
